
Here the Peak Dates for Fall Foliage in Korea 🍁🍂 Those dates are just a rough forecast for this year and they are of course dependent on many things, especially the weather in the next weeks. Usually the leaves start to change color around 10-14 days before the peak time and start falling down afterwards 🍁 Comment “FALL” to get the Link to my Fall Foliage Guide (currently on Sale for 5$) 💌 Here the list of Dates for the Korean Mountains (best place to see the foliage of course: ⛰️ Bukhansan: First 10/16, Peak 10/28 ⛰️ Seoraksan: First 9/29, Peak 10/20 ⛰️ Odaesan: First 10/4, Peak 10/17 ⛰️ Chiaksan: First 10/9, Peak 10/23 ⛰️ Woraksan: First 10/15, Peak 10/28 ⛰️ Songnisan: First 10/17, Peak 10/30 ⛰️ Gyeryongsan: First 10/16, Peak 10/29 ⛰️ Palgongsan: First 10/18, Peak 10/29 ⛰️ Gayasan: First 10/16, Peak 10/27 ⛰️ Naejangsan: First 10/24, Peak 11/5 ⛰️ Mudeungsan: First 10/21, Peak 11/4 ⛰️ Duryunsan: First 10/29, Peak 11/11 ⛰️ Jirisan: First 10/20, Peak 10/27 ⛰️ Hallasan: First 10/14, Peak 10/28 #korea #fallfoliage #southkorea #seoul #busan #jeonju #daejeon #autumn #gangneung #daegu #korean
